随着科技的不断发展,体育产业也迎来了前所未有的变革。体育科技不仅改变了我们的健身方式,还对竞技体育产生了深远的影响。本文将深入探讨体育科技革新的各个方面,包括健身追踪、数据分析、智能训练以及虚拟现实在体育领域的应用,揭示这些变革如何重塑我们的健身与竞技体验。

一、健身追踪:个性化健身方案的诞生

健身追踪器自诞生以来,便成为人们关注的热点。这些设备可以实时监测运动者的心率、卡路里消耗、步数等数据,为用户提供个性化的健身方案。

1. 智能手环

智能手环是最常见的健身追踪器之一。通过连接手机应用,用户可以查看自己的运动数据,并根据数据调整健身计划。

# 示例:智能手环数据统计
class SmartBand:
    def __init__(self, steps, heart_rate):
        self.steps = steps
        self.heart_rate = heart_rate

    def display_data(self):
        print(f"步数:{self.steps}")
        print(f"心率:{self.heart_rate}")

# 创建智能手环实例并显示数据
band = SmartBand(10000, 120)
band.display_data()

2. 跑步手表

跑步手表是针对跑步运动者设计的智能设备。它不仅能追踪跑步数据,还能提供路线导航、音乐播放等功能。

# 示例:跑步手表数据统计
class RunningWatch:
    def __init__(self, distance, time, pace):
        self.distance = distance
        self.time = time
        self.pace = pace

    def display_data(self):
        print(f"距离:{self.distance}公里")
        print(f"时间:{self.time}分钟")
        print(f"配速:{self.pace}分钟/公里")

# 创建跑步手表实例并显示数据
watch = RunningWatch(10, 60, 6)
watch.display_data()

二、数据分析:助力运动员突破自我

数据分析在体育领域的应用日益广泛。通过对运动员的比赛数据进行深入分析,可以帮助教练和运动员找出不足,优化训练策略。

1. 生物力学分析

生物力学分析可以评估运动员的动作是否合理,有助于预防运动损伤。

# 示例:生物力学分析代码
def biomechanical_analysis(data):
    # 分析数据
    pass

# 假设数据
data = {
    'force': 1000,
    'moment': 500,
    'angle': 30
}

biomechanical_analysis(data)

2. 机器学习预测

通过机器学习算法,可以预测运动员在比赛中的表现,为教练提供决策依据。

# 示例:机器学习预测代码
from sklearn.linear_model import LinearRegression

# 假设数据
X = [[1, 2, 3]]
y = [10]

# 创建模型并训练
model = LinearRegression()
model.fit(X, y)

# 预测
prediction = model.predict([[4, 5, 6]])
print(f"预测结果:{prediction}")

三、智能训练:个性化训练计划的制定

智能训练系统可以根据运动员的生理数据和运动表现,为其制定个性化的训练计划。

1. 个性化训练算法

通过分析运动员的生理数据和运动表现,智能训练算法可以为运动员制定合适的训练计划。

# 示例:个性化训练算法代码
def personalized_training_plan(athlete_data):
    # 根据数据制定训练计划
    pass

# 假设运动员数据
athlete_data = {
    'age': 25,
    'height': 180,
    'weight': 70,
    'heart_rate': 120
}

personalized_training_plan(athlete_data)

2. 智能穿戴设备

智能穿戴设备可以实时监测运动员的生理数据,确保训练过程中的安全。

# 示例:智能穿戴设备代码
class SmartClothing:
    def __init__(self, athlete_data):
        self.athlete_data = athlete_data

    def monitor_data(self):
        # 监测运动员的生理数据
        pass

# 创建智能穿戴设备实例
smart_clothing = SmartClothing(athlete_data)
smart_clothing.monitor_data()

四、虚拟现实:打造沉浸式运动体验

虚拟现实技术为体育爱好者提供了全新的运动体验,让人们可以在虚拟世界中畅享运动乐趣。

1. 虚拟运动游戏

虚拟运动游戏可以让玩家在游戏中体验各种运动项目,如篮球、足球、赛车等。

# 示例:虚拟运动游戏代码
def virtual_sports_game():
    # 游戏逻辑
    pass

virtual_sports_game()

2. 虚拟健身器材

虚拟健身器材可以模拟真实器材的运动轨迹,为用户提供沉浸式的健身体验。

# 示例:虚拟健身器材代码
def virtual_fitness_equipment():
    # 器材运动轨迹模拟
    pass

virtual_fitness_equipment()

五、结语

体育科技的快速发展,正在重塑我们的健身与竞技体验。通过智能化、个性化、沉浸式的创新手段,体育产业将迎来更加美好的未来。我们期待看到更多令人惊喜的体育科技产品,让每个人都能享受到运动带来的快乐。